Mathesar
- A nonprofit or research group whose data is already in PostgreSQL and whose staff cannot write SQLnot Amazon Aurora
- Giving analysts a safe editing interface governed by database roles that already existnot Amazon Aurora
- Replacing a hand built Django or Rails admin screen that nobody wants to maintainnot Amazon Aurora
- Editing production reference data where an export, edit and reimport cycle would risk losing concurrent changesnot Amazon Aurora
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
Amazon Aurora
- Aurora requires AWS ecosystem knowledge and integration with other AWS services
- Pricing can become expensive with high-traffic applications using many read replicas
- Limited support for non-relational data types compared to NoSQL alternatives
Mathesar
- There is no hosted offering of any kind, so a team without someone who can run and secure a server cannot use it at all.
- It works only with PostgreSQL, so a MySQL, SQL Server or SQLite estate is excluded outright.
- There are no automations, no webhooks and effectively no integration catalogue, so it edits data and does nothing else.
- Because it writes to the live database, a careless bulk edit or column type change is a production change with no staging step and no undo.
- Development is grant and community funded rather than commercially funded, so roadmap pace and long term continuity carry a different risk profile from a venture backed vendor.

Answered from the vendors’ own pages
Amazon Aurora: Is Amazon Aurora compatible with MySQL and PostgreSQL?
Yes, Amazon Aurora offers MySQL and PostgreSQL compatibility with full compatibility to their open-source counterparts, allowing you to migrate existing databases with standard tools.
SourceMathesar: Is there a cloud version?
No. Self hosting is the only option, and that is a deliberate project decision rather than a gap waiting to be filled.
Amazon Aurora: What uptime SLA does Amazon Aurora provide?
Aurora is designed for up to 99.99% single-region uptime and 99.999% multi-region uptime with automatic failover.
SourceMathesar: How does it handle permissions?
Through PostgreSQL roles and privileges directly, so there is no second permission model to keep in step.
Amazon Aurora: How much does Amazon Aurora cost?
Aurora uses serverless, usage-based pricing where you pay only for consumed capacity. Typical pricing ranges from $50-70 per month for minimal setups to $400-600 per month for small production clusters.
SourceMathesar: What is the row limit?
Whatever PostgreSQL can handle. Mathesar adds no storage layer of its own.
Amazon Aurora: Can Amazon Aurora scale automatically?
Yes, Aurora automatically scales to match workload demands without performance degradation, supporting both read and write scaling.
SourceMathesar: Does it support databases other than PostgreSQL?
No.
Amazon Aurora: How many read replicas does Aurora support?
Aurora supports up to 15 low-latency read replicas for distributing read traffic across your application.
SourceMathesar: Can it replace Airtable?
Only for editing and exploring data. There are no automations, apps or integrations.
